Hardscape curbing installation services involve the creation of durable, defined borders around landscape features such as lawns, garden beds, walkways, and patios. These borders are typically constructed using materials like concrete, stone, or brick, and are designed to provide a clean, finished appearance while also serving functional purposes. The installation process often includes preparing the ground, setting the curbing material, and ensuring proper alignment and stability to withstand foot traffic and weather conditions. Skilled contractors focus on achieving precise edges that complement the overall landscape design and enhance curb appeal.
This service addresses common landscape challenges such as soil erosion, weed intrusion, and uneven terrain. Installing curbing helps contain mulch, gravel, or other ground covers, preventing them from spilling into adjacent areas. It also acts as a barrier that keeps grass and weeds from encroaching into flower beds or pathways, reducing maintenance needs. Additionally, well-installed curbing can improve drainage by directing water runoff away from structures and preventing soil washout. These benefits contribute to a more organized, low-maintenance outdoor space that retains its aesthetic appeal over time.

Material Costs - The cost of curbing materials typically ranges from $10 to $25 per linear foot, depending on the type of stone or concrete used. For example, basic concrete curbing might be around $12 per foot, while decorative stone options can be closer to $20 per foot.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ually adds $8 to $15 per linear foot to the project, influenced by site complexity and local labor rates. For a standard driveway border, labor costs might total approximately $10 per foot.
Project Size & Scope - Larger or more intricate curbing projects tend to cost more per linear foot, with total expenses ranging from $1,200 to $4,000 for 100 feet of curbing. Smaller or straightforward installations often fall at the lower end of this range.
Additional Costs - Extra charges may apply for site preparation, such as excavation or grading, which can add several hundred dollars to the overall cost. These costs vary based on the condition of the existing terrain and accessibility.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
